Average Cost to Update a 5x10 Bathroom

Figuring out the estimated price to remodel a small 5x10 bathroom can depend on several factors. , Generally speaking, you can expect spending somewhere between $3,000 - $7,000. This estimate includes the cost of materials. A basic remodel may only cost {$3,000, while a more detailed bathroom transformation can reach upwards of $7,000.

  • Several things impact the total cost:
  • the type of materials you choose
  • the local labor market
  • how extensive the remodel is

Planning Your 5x10 Bathroom Remodel: Cost Considerations

Tackling a restroom remodel can be an exciting endeavor, but it's essential to factor more info in cost implications before diving headfirst into renovations. A thorough budget will prevent unexpected expenses and ensure your project stays on track. Start by investigating average costs for materials, labor, and likely permits in your area.

  • Obtain multiple quotes from reliable contractors to contrast prices and ensure you're getting a fair deal.

Don't forget to account for the cost of unexpected repairs that may happen during demolition. Set aside a contingency fund for these circumstances, aiming for approximately 10% to 20% of your total budget.
